- The collision happened around 10:40pm on Monday near the Cargo Fleet Lane junction, with the police vehicle reportedly using blue lights while responding to a call.
- A male driver sustained fractures to his pelvis and collar bone and is receiving treatment at James Cook University Hospital, and a police officer suffered minor injuries.
- North East Ambulance Service dispatched three crews, a specialist paramedic and a duty officer, and two patients were taken to James Cook.
- The A66 was closed in both directions overnight for emergency response and vehicle recovery before reopening on Tuesday morning.
